Introduction
God's original intention for humanity has always been clear: for mankind to dwell on earth in harmony with Him, reflecting His Kingdom. This truth is echoed in Psalm 115:16, "The heaven, even the heavens, are the Lord’s; but the earth He has given to the children of men." The earth is not just our temporary home but the place where God's eternal plan will unfold.
The Garden of Eden: A Picture of God’s Plan
In the beginning, God planted the tree of life in the Garden of Eden, allowing humanity to live forever in perfect communion with Him (Genesis 2:9). However, when Adam and Eve disobeyed and ate from the tree of the knowledge of good and evil, sin entered the world, bringing death and separation from God (Genesis 2:17).
God, in His mercy, removed humanity from the garden, preventing access to the tree of life (Genesis 3:22-23). This was not an act of punishment but one of protection. Living forever in a sinful state would have been a fate far from God’s perfect plan.
The Promise of Restoration
Through Jesus Christ, the promise of eternal life is restored. Revelation reminds us of the ultimate reward for those who overcome: "To him who overcomes I will give to eat from the tree of life, which is in the midst of the Paradise of God" (Revelation 2:7). God’s Kingdom will be fully realized on earth, and the righteous will dwell in harmony with Him forever.
Living as Kingdom Citizens
Jesus calls us to seek first the Kingdom of God and His righteousness (Matthew 6:33). To live as Kingdom citizens means to align our lives with His principles, trusting in His provision and promise. The earth, as an extension of God’s Kingdom, is meant to reflect His glory and be inhabited by the righteous.
The Bible assures us that evil will not prevail. "For evildoers shall be cut off; but those who wait on the Lord, they shall inherit the earth" (Psalm 37:9). This promise is a source of hope and encouragement for all believers.
